Another simple job but one that was ideal for digital printing. These sample caps were completed in a matter of minutes, and again show the versatility of being able to produce one-offs and sample work quickly, and at lower cost than setting up for screen printing for proofing purposes. The challenge with this font for Pepsi was that the print area was curved but had too large a radius for Rotary printing.
Pad printing wasn’t an option, so it had to be Screen printed. Because of the curve a screen and squeegee had to be modified to enable an accurate print of the Pepsi logo with no distortion and keep the three colours in register. We produce and print. These trays were printed for well known restaurant brands, the requirement was simply to reverse print onto a durable material as a self adhesive tray insert.
What we added to the job was to reverse print onto a clear textured material with a non-slip quality. This added dimension gave the finished result a useful edge in the catering industry.
